Mailinglisten-Archive |
Hi
Am Die, 22 Feb 2000 schrieb Michael Ackermann:
> >Als work-around kannste ja folgende Abfrage machen
> >"SELECT DISTINCT IP FROM counter".
> >Danach fragst Du einfach die Anzahl der "Rows" ab (mysql_num_rows() unter
> >PHP).
> Danke! hab dem so gemacht
>
> $res1= mysql_query("select DISTINCT IP from $tbl_counter") ;
> while($result1=mysql_fetch_array($res1)) {
> $query2 = "select count(*) from counter where IP='$result1[IP]'";
> $res2 = mysql_query($query2);
> $zahl =mysql_fetch_array($res2);
> }
Hmmm... du willst also nicht wissen, wieviele unterschiedliche IP-Adr. du in
der Tabelle hast, sondern wieviele Einträge je Adresse?
Das geht natürlich auch wie du das gemacht hast, einfacher ist aber
SELECT IP, count(IP) from counter group by IP;
Du bekommst alle Adressen mit der Häufigkeit in der Tabelle aufgelistet.
Ciao, Rene
--
----------------------------------------------------------------------
mailto:rene.fertig_(at)_wtal.de http://home.telebel.de/referti/
======================================================================
>>>>>>>>>>>> PGP-Key auf Anfrage +++ PGP-Key on request <<<<<<<<<<<<
---
*** Abmelden von dieser Mailingliste funktioniert per E-Mail
*** an mysql-de-request_(at)_lists.4t2.com mit Betreff/Subject: unsubscribe
php::bar PHP Wiki - Listenarchive